Corrosion is a natural process that degrades materials, particularly metals, when they react with environmental factors such as moisture and chemicals. In industries like construction, marine, and automotive, the financial implications of corrosion can be significant, costing billions globally each year.
This specialized steel offers enhanced resistance against rust and staining compared to traditional steel. Its unique alloy composition, primarily featuring chromium, forms a protective layer that shields it from corrosive elements, making it ideal for long-term use in harsh conditions.
According to the National Association of Corrosion Engineers (NACE), corrosion costs the U.S. economy approximately $276 billion annually. Using corrosion resistant stainless plate steel can dramatically reduce these costs, making it a prudent choice for many projects.
